Linux操作指令

mv 旧名字 新名字 –改名
mv 名字 路径 –移动
rm -rf 文件 –删除
ln -sf /usr/share/zoneinfo/Asia/Shanghai /etc/localtime –修改时区|
ln -s /app/nodejs/bin/node /usr/local/bin/ –软连接
tar -xvf –解压
ps -ef | grep 服务名字 查看配置文件
netstat -tunlp|grep 8080 端口占用情况
netstat -antp 查看全部服务情况

防火墙


systemctl stop firewalld.service            #停止firewall
systemctl disable firewalld.service        #禁止firewall开机启动

其他常用命令:

 firewall-cmd –state                          ##查看防火墙状态,是否是running
firewall-cmd –reload                          ##重新载入配置,比如添加规则之后,需要执行此命令
firewall-cmd –get-zones                      ##列出支持的zone
firewall-cmd –get-services                    ##列出支持的服务,在列表中的服务是放行的
firewall-cmd –query-service ftp              ##查看ftp服务是否支持,返回yes或者no
firewall-cmd –add-service=ftp                ##临时开放ftp服务
firewall-cmd –add-service=ftp –permanent    ##永久开放ftp服务
firewall-cmd –remove-service=ftp –permanent  ##永久移除ftp服务
firewall-cmd –add-port=80/tcp –permanent    ##永久添加80端口 
iptables -L -n                                ##查看规则,这个命令是和iptables的相同的
man firewall-cmd                              ##查看帮助


端口

firewall-cmd –zone=public –add-port=80/tcp –permanent

–zone #作用域
–add-port=80/tcp #添加端口,格式为:端口/通讯协议
–permanent #永久生效,没有此参数重启后失效